八度如何平滑?

时间:2014-08-21 21:22:16

标签: matlab octave smooth loess

我正在尝试在Octave中运行一段MATLAB代码,而且我已经上线了:

xsm = smooth(x,0.03,'loess') 

似乎没有八度音阶。 x只是几千个实数的数组。

是否有任何Octave代码可以为我执行此操作,如果没有,我在哪里可以找到算法以便我可以编写自己的代码?如果我这样做,我如何将其贡献给Octave?

2 个答案:

答案 0 :(得分:3)

看起来有人已经实现了它:smooth.m或者Octave-Forge上的data smoothing package

答案 1 :(得分:0)

这里是Excel Basic中的一些黄土代码,可能是一个开始:

http://peltiertech.com/WordPress/loess-smoothing-in-excel/